This paper is a continuation of [8]. We study weighted function spaces of type B   pq 3and F   pq 3on the Euclidean space R n , where u is a weight function of at most exponential growth. In particular, u (χ (±|χ|) is an admissible weight. We deal with atomic decompositions of these spaces. Furthermore, we prove that the spaces B   pq 3and F   pq 3are isomorphic to the corresponding unweighted spaces B   pq 3and F   pq 3 .
